Read the full editionThe Supreme Judicial Council (SJC) has announced the suspension of all court hearings from Sunday, March 15, for a period of two weeks.
This action comes within the framework of the preventive efforts and measures taken by the State of Qatar to curb the spread of the coronavirus (COVID-19).
